VIJAYAPURA:

No matter how often the public is exhorted to practise precautionary social distancing in a time of coronavirus, many people — including netas who should be leading by example — couldn’t care less. In Karnataka alone, there have been at least 3-4 instances of VIP weddings with hundreds in attendance — a surefire prescription for Covid-19 infection.

In such a casual, undisciplined scenario,  where humans aren’t setting a good example,  maybe one particular bovine can!
A picture of a cow ‘practising’ its own intuitive version of ‘social distancing’ has drawn much attention. The incident happened  in Basavana Bagewadi town of Vijayapur district on Sunday. The cow is clearly keeping its distancewhile standing in front of a bakery, hoping to get lucky!

In fact, call it coincidence or something only the cow can reveal (if only it could talk!), the four-legged ‘customer’ is actually standing on a ‘social distancing’ square drawn in front of the shop for humans!

Post-script: The bovine’s patience was rewarded with a tasty mouthful offered by the shopkeeper.
